On modern Windows (8, 10, 11), the game is often installed in Program Files , which is a protected directory. If the Player Editor is not run as Administrator, Windows blocks it from reading/writing the files, resulting in a "not found" or "access denied" variant error.
: Right-click your player editor executable, select Properties , head to the Compatibility tab, and check Run this program as an administrator . This forces Windows to grant the tool permission to read and write files within system folders.

This report addresses the recurring issue where users encounter a "File Not Found" error when attempting to open or use a Player Editor (such as the widely used "Cricket 07 Player Editor" by Alok) with EA Sports Cricket 07. The error typically prevents users from editing player stats, rosters, or team lineups. The primary cause is incorrect installation pathing or file association.
